Job Summary:
This hybrid role requires a minimum of three days per week on-site. The primary responsibility is translating technical specifications into functional, tested Siebel CRM applications. This includes programming, debugging, unit testing, and troubleshooting software issues. The successful candidate will collaborate with IT professionals throughout the software development lifecycle, design and develop CRM applications, and maintain comprehensive documentation. Strong anal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ills are essential.

Responsibilities:
- Translate technical specifications into functional, tested CRM applications.
- Program, debug, and unit test Siebel CRM applications.
- Troubleshoot and resolve software issues.
- Collaborate with IT professionals throughout the SDLC.
- Design, code, test, debug, and document CRM applications using structured methodologies.
- Develop and execute unit testing scripts.
- Configure Siebel environments (picklists, LOVs, multilingual support, data visibility).
- Integrate Siebel with web services and middleware.
- Create and maintain technical documentation (blueprints, build-books, manuals).
- Share knowledge and code with internal staff.
- Work with relational and hierarchical databases and query languages.
- Ensure application adherence to AODA, WCAG, and web accessibility standards.
- Participate in agile project delivery.
Required Skills & Certifications:
- 5+ years hands-on Siebel Public Sector 8.x experience, including recent experience with Siebel IP 2018+.
- 3+ years Siebel data model, OpenUI, Smart Scripts, and e-Services experience.
- 2+ years PM/PR scripting with OpenUI.
- 5+ years experience developing/testing scripts and configuring multi-org data structures in Siebel.
- Experience with BI Publisher Reports and integrating Siebel with web services.
- Hands-on experience with AODA/WCAG and accessibility technologies.
- Experience in agile teams and documentation best practices.
- Proficiency in object-oriented and/or third-generation programming languages (Java, JavaScript, jQuery, HTML5, CSS).
Preferred Skills & Certifications:
- Knowledge of rapid application development (RAD), internet-ready applications, and information management principles.
- Experience with installation script modifications and post-implementation support.
- Experience conducting design walkthroughs and creating user/system documentation.
